Onion (Allium cepa) anthotype by Laure Martin

Onion (Allium cepa) anthotype by Laure Martin

“Wings of hope” by Laure Martin
Country: France
Parts used: Peels
Application: Brushing
Exposure time: 1 week
Month, season and year: June, Spring, 2022
Substrate: Watercolour paper
Contrast of final print: ** (Medium)

Ashoka tree (Saraca asoca) +2 other anthotype by Archana Verma Kakar

Arjuna tree (Terminalia Arjuna) + Others anthotype by Archana Verma Kakar

“Epiphany” by Archana Verma Kakar
Country: India
Plants used: Turmeric, Onion skins, and my homemade brown ink from the Arjuna tree
Parts used: Flowers
Application: Brushing
Exposure time: 5 hours
Month, season and year: August, summer 2022
Substrate: Bustro 300gsm Watercolour paper (25 percent cotton)
Contrast of final print: ** (Medium)

Turmeric (Curcuma longa L.) anthotype by Dalene Marais

Turmeric (Curcuma longa L.) anthotype by Dalene Marais

“Hope from Africa with love” by Dalene Marais
Country: South Africa
Parts used: Powder
Application: Brushing
Exposure time: 8 hours in SA sun (UV 6 out of 10)
Month, season and year: August, Winter, 2022
Substrate: Rough watercolour paper 300 g
Contrast of final print: * (Low)

Turmeric (Curcuma longa) anthotype by Blueprint

Turmeric (Curcuma longa) anthotype by Blueprint

“Caballo” (Horse) by Blueprint
Country: Spain
Parts used: Root powder
Application: Immersion
Exposure time: 96 hours
Month, season and year: August, Summer, 2017
Substrate: Watercolour paper, 280 g
Contrast of final print: ** (Medium)

Strawberry, (Fragaria x ananassa) anthotype by Astrid Robertsson

Strawberry (Fragaria x ananassa) anthotype by Astrid Robertsson

“Fragile” by Astrid Robertsson
Country: Switzerland
Parts used: Stem and leaves
Application: Foam brush
Exposure time: 3-4 hours.
Month, season and year: July, Summer 2022.
Substrate: Bergger 100% cotton (non-sensitized paper for alternative processes)
Contrast of final print: ** (Medium)
